Ballypatrick, Clonmel.

Oliver passed away peacefully, surrounded by his family, in the wonderful care of the staff at Connolly Hospital, Blanchardstown on Friday morning.

Pre-deceased by his parents Matt and Johanna and his sister Eileen (Walsh) he is deeply regretted by his sister Bridget (Slyman), cousins, nieces, nephews, brother-in-law and his many friends and neighbours.

May He Rest in Peace

Reposing at Condons Funeral Parlour, Clonmel on Monday evening from 5.30pm to 7pm.

Removal on Tuesday to St John the Baptist Church, Kilcash with Funeral Mass on arrival at 12pm.

Burial afterwards in the adjoining cemetery.

Ar dheis Dé go raibh a Anam Dílis

Messages of condolence may be left on the Condons Funeral Directors Facebook page.
